Billionaire Romance: The Clean Contract

Rate this book
A billionaire who built an empire to prove his worth.
A PR consultant desperate to save her sister.
A marriage contract that wasn't supposed to include falling in love.

Grant Blackridge has everything except the one thing investors demand: personal stability. When a scandal threatens his $2 billion acquisition, he makes a calculated decision, hire a wife.

Elise Ward is a brilliant reputation management consultant facing an impossible choice: watch her sister's illness consume their savings, or accept six months of marriage to a man she barely knows for $800,000.

The contract is clear: separate bedrooms, no emotional entanglement, part ways after six months. It's a transaction, nothing more.

But living together changes everything.

Morning coffee becomes conversation. Professional distance becomes genuine partnership. And somewhere between the carefully maintained boundaries and the moments they forget to perform, Grant and Elise discover that the most dangerous clause in their contract is the one prohibiting what they're already feeling.

When an investigative journalist exposes their arrangement, Grant faces an impossible choice: lie to save his empire, or tell the truth and risk losing everything he's built.

Elise believes she's destroying his life by staying. Grant knows he can't survive without her.

One contract. Six months. And a love that was never supposed to be real.

The Clean Contract is a closed-door contemporary romance featuring a marriage of convenience, forced proximity, emotional slow burn, and a billionaire who learns that vulnerability is the ultimate power move. Perfect for readers who love intense emotional connection without explicit content.

This book started out ok, a Billionaire CEO proposing a contract marriage to save his image. He decided the Crisis manager that comes to help him is his pick for his wife. From there this book went back and forth at holding my attention. The woman, Elise has problems with panic attacks and leaving when she feels that the relationship is too intense. The CEO is steady in his reasoning but the woman bothered me with all her demands. She has done everything alone and has a hard time accepting help. So she is always looking for reasons to be mad at her husband. This book is predictable in that the marriage contract is found out by the media and they have to come out clean. It causes havoc all the way around. I wouldn’t recommend this book. I almost quit reading it.

I really enjoyed this clean billionaire romance! It proves you don’t need explicit scenes to tell a heartfelt and engaging love story. The contract marriage premise was well done, and I loved watching the relationship develop from a simple agreement into something built on trust, respect, and genuine affection.

The characters were easy to connect with, and their emotional growth felt authentic. There were plenty of sweet moments, a little drama to keep things interesting, and a satisfying slow-burn romance that had me cheering for them from beginning to end.

If you’re looking for a wholesome billionaire romance with memorable characters, emotional depth, and a well-earned happily-ever-after, this is definitely one to pick up. I’ll be looking for more books by this author.
